Simply a guess here, but because File Explorer (ever since Windows 7, I think) treats ZIP files very similar to a folder. If you click on the ZIP file in the left pane of File Explorer, it's contents are shown in the right pane. It appears that the files are in a folder, but Windows is just displaying the contents of the ZIP file. Therefore, I think you might be running the program without actually unzipping the ZIP file. You may also notice that the icon for a compressed/ZIP file is very similar to a folder; if you examine them closely, I think you'll find a zipper shown on the ZIP file icon.

So, I'm guessing you need to extract the ZIP file before running the program. To do so, right-click the ZIP file you downloaded and choose "Extract to folder ______". The "________" should be the same name as the ZIP file. After you have extracted it that, you can open that newly created folder and then the program should run as intended.
